构建动态交互的Web应用是一个复杂的过程,涉及到前端和后端的开发。以下是一个简单的步骤指南,用于创建一个简单的动态交互的Web应用:
1. 确定需求和目标:首先,你需要明确你的应用需要实现什么功能,以及你的目标用户是谁。这将帮助你确定应用的主要功能和设计方向。
2. 选择合适的技术栈:根据你的需求和目标,选择合适的技术栈。例如,如果你需要一个响应式的Web应用,你可能会选择HTML、CSS和JavaScript;如果你需要一个复杂的数据管理系统,你可能会选择Node.js和MongoDB。
3. 设计UI/UX:在开发之前,你需要设计一个清晰的用户界面(UI)和用户体验(UX)。这包括确定页面布局、颜色方案、字体选择等。你还需要考虑如何使应用易于使用,并提供良好的导航和搜索功能。
4. 编写前端代码:使用HTML、CSS和JavaScript编写前端代码。HTML用于创建页面结构,CSS用于样式化页面,而JavaScript用于添加交互性。你可以使用框架(如React、Vue或Angular)来简化开发过程。
5. 后端开发:根据你的需求,开发后端代码。这可能包括处理用户输入、存储数据、与数据库进行交互等。你可以选择Node.js、Python、Java等编程语言,并使用相应的数据库(如MySQL、MongoDB、PostgreSQL等)。
6. 测试和调试:确保你的应用在不同的浏览器和设备上都能正常工作。同时,使用单元测试和集成测试来确保代码的正确性。
7. 部署和维护:将你的应用部署到服务器上,并定期更新和维护。这可能包括修复漏洞、添加新功能、优化性能等。
8. 收集反馈和改进:根据用户的反馈和评价,不断改进你的应用。这可能包括改进UI/UX、增加新功能、优化性能等。
总之,构建动态交互的Web应用需要综合考虑前端和后端的开发,以及用户体验和性能的优化。通过遵循上述步骤,你可以创建一个既美观又实用的Web应用。